A new principal is taking the reins at a Henderson elementary school. WNIN’s John Gibson reports:
The school district says Ryan Maher is the new principal of East Heights Elementary.
Maher brings 20 years of experience in education to the role, including experience as an assistant principal, instructional coach, and elementary classroom teacher.
The Henderson County School district says throughout his career, Maher has focused on supporting students, teachers, and families while building strong relationships and positive school communities.
Maher has served as an assistant principal at both Central Academy and Spottsville Elementary and previously worked as a Student Services/Instructional Coach at Central Academy.
His teaching experience includes Kindergarten, second grade, and fifth grade, along with experience as a Title I Math Specialist and Curriculum Coach.
He holds a Bachelor of Science in Education from Pittsburg State University and a Master’s Degree in Educational Administration from the University of Scranton.
The new school year begins Thursday in Henderson County schools.
